Officer on Duty (2025) is an intense crime thriller directed by Jithu Ashraf, starring Kunchacko Boban, along with Priyamani, Jagadish, Vishak Nair, and Leya Mammen. The film dives into drug trafficking, crime, and corruption, following a cop’s relentless pursuit of justice. Written by Shahi Kabir, the screenplay blends mystery, action, and emotional drama, keeping audiences engaged throughout.

Plot & Storyline

The story follows Circle Inspector Harishankar, played by Kunchacko Boban, who is haunted by his past while investigating a seemingly simple case of gold chain theft. His inquiry soon leads him to a series of mysterious suicides, including that of a fellow officer and his daughter. As the case unfolds, Harishankar uncovers a terrifying network of drug abuse and corruption, mirroring personal tragedies from his past.

The film not only showcases police procedural elements but also sheds light on violence against women and the devastating effects of drugs on youth. With an emotional core and high-stakes drama, Officer on Duty takes viewers through an intense and unsettling journey.

Cast & Performances

One of the strongest aspects of the film is the powerful performances:

  • Kunchacko Boban delivers a gripping and emotionally intense performance as Harishankar, portraying a cop weighed down by trauma yet determined to seek justice.
  • Priyamani plays Geetha, Harishankar’s wife, effectively depicting the struggles of a woman caught in emotional turmoil.
  • Jagadish and Vishak Nair bring depth and menace to their roles as key figures in the crime syndicate.
  • Leya Mammen and Aishwarya Raj add weight to the film’s emotional and investigative angles.

Direction & Technical Aspects

Director Jithu Ashraf creates a well-structured crime thriller, balancing emotion with suspense. The cinematography by Roby Varghese Raj enhances the gritty atmosphere, making every scene visually engaging.

  • Jakes Bejoy’s background score intensifies the drama, though some songs feel unnecessary.
  • Chaman Chakko’s sharp editing maintains a gripping pace.
  • Sankaran A.S.’s sound design adds a realistic, eerie touch.
  • Shahi Kabir’s screenplay starts strong but leans on predictable crime thriller tropes.

While the investigative sequences are thrilling, some convenient plot twists and clichés reduce originality.

Reviews & Ratings

Critics have given mixed to positive reviews, praising performances and cinematography while critiquing predictability and overused crime drama elements.

  • Filmy Focus rated it 2.5/5, calling it a decent investigative thriller but pointing out flaws in dubbing and execution.
  • Times of India rated it 3.0/5, appreciating the dark atmosphere and social commentary, but criticizing the film’s overuse of violence against women as a plot device.
  • Nowrunning praised Kunchacko Boban’s performance but felt the storytelling was formulaic.
  • Public audience ratings stand at 3.2/5, with viewers enjoying the thrills but finding the climax predictable.
